Saskia es Co-fundadora y vocera de Reinserta, una organización sin fines de lucro que busca romper los círculos de delincuencia para mejorar la seguridad del país, trabajando con el sistema penitenciario.
Ha cumplido diversos roles vinculando a la sociedad civil con gobiernos locales y federal, entre ellos, por nombramiento directo del Presidente de la República, funge como Invitada Permanente de la Sociedad Civil al Consejo Nacional de Seguridad Pública.
Es conferencista de temas como la reconstrucción del tejido social, reinserción, seguridad y niñez en prisión. Ha sido receptora de numerosos premios entre los que destaca el de “Love Prize for Youth Advocacy” en la 17va Cumbre de los Premios Nobel de la Paz que recibió a nombre de Reinserta.
Es co-autora de los libros “Un Sicario en Cada Hijo te Dio”, un libro sobre las niñas y niños cooptados por el crimen organizado en México y “No es No. Guía de actuación ante la violencia sexual en México: conoce, actúa, denuncia y acompaña”.
Hoy Saskia y yo hablamos de miedo, de la mente de los criminales más peligrosos de México y de la responsabilidad que tenemos todos en la construcción de un país más seguro.

In 1992, David Wood was convicted of murdering young women and girls and burying them in the desert outside El Paso, earning him the nickname the Desert Killer. More than 30 years later, his lawyers have one last chance to argue his innocence and stop his execution. “The Last 12 Weeks” follows a team of capital defense lawyers as they try to save their client’s life. The series, produced by Serial Productions and The New York Times in collaboration with The Marshall Project, focuses on the high stakes and at times bizarre work involved in trying to halt an execution. With an extraordinary level of access to a capital case in its final stretch, the longtime death penalty reporter Maurice Chammah takes listeners into the room with the lawyers as the clock ticks down. Maurice and Alvin Melathe, a producer, follow members of the defense team as they look for alternate suspects, try to find new evidence to poke holes in the case, and track down hard-to-find witnesses. In the end, will the lawyers’ efforts be enough to persuade a deeply skeptical court system — and stop an execution three decades in the making? “The Last 12 Weeks.” A five-part series … on a deadline.
